A NEW knife amnesty has been launched in Clacton.
The campaign, which will feature specially designed knife bins, got under way at the Only Cowards Carry antiweapons charity in the town’s Jackson Road yesterday.
The project is being supported by Essex Police, the county’s police and crime commissioner Nick Alston, and Tendring Council.
It follows a successful trial last summer, which saw more than 400 bladed items handed in to Clacton police station.
